SUBJECT

The essential subject of this contract is the rental of the vessel owned by you as indicated in the Particular Conditions, in adequate navigable conditions for exclusive use for recreational and private navigation, according to the terms and conditions agreed by the parties in this contract.

RENTAL PERIOD

The TENANT/CLIENT rents the referenced vessel for the maximum duration specified in the Particular Conditions. This term may be extended by the express written consent of both parties.

A delay in the removal of the vessel by the TENANT/CLIENT, for reasons attributable to him, shall not constitute an extension of the rental term.

A delay in the return of the vessel by the TENANT/CLIENT to its home port shall entitle the L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L to retain the deposit and claim from the former as provided in the Clause.

PICKUP AND DELIVERY LOCATION

The vessel will be delivered to the TENANT/CLIENT at the port and time indicated in this contract. The vessel will be insured, ready to sail, equipped with all necessary gear, and with full water, fuel, and gas tanks.

If adverse weather conditions force the TENANT/CLIENT to delay their initial or subsequent departures, there will be no price reduction, nor an extension of the agreed period established in this document, unless expressly agreed by both parties.

Before the vessel is handed over, both parties will inspect the vessel and sign the CHECK IN (inventory). Once completed, the Tenant will sign the CHECK IN (inventory) to express their approval. Acceptance of the boat and signing of the inventory assumes that it is in good condition and that the Tenant accepts the conditions of this contract.

The vessel must be returned to the Landlord within the timeframe specified in the Particular Conditions of this contract and as specified in the Clause.

DEPOSIT

The Tenant must provide L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L with the amount specified in the Particular Conditions as a deposit.

THE TENANT/CLIENT shall deliver at the time of signing the contract, as a DEPOSIT, the amount described in the Particular Conditions. The DEPOSIT will be secured by a VISA credit card to ensure compliance with the obligations contained in this contract. This amount will be returned to the TENANT/CLIENT once the rental contract has ended and it is verified by SAILWAY that the vessel is in good condition and that the obligations of the tenant have been fulfilled. To this end, it may be necessary to retain the deposit for up to a maximum of 7 days after the vessel is returned.

The L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L is responsible for any loss, damage, or breakdown occurring, both on the rented vessel and on any of its auxiliary elements, such as the auxiliary vessel and everything inventoried and verified in the document signed by both parties "Check in-out". Should any of the aforementioned circumstances occur, or delays in scheduled deliveries, L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L will retain and accrue from the deposit until compensating for damages or losses incurred both materially and for lost profits. The TENANT/CLIENT shall pay the total of the deposited deposit according to the invoices of such damages, losses, or repairs incurred based on Sailway's suppliers and respective labor.

The TENANT/CLIENT must immediately notify L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L of any accident, mishap, breakdown, or incident regardless of its nature. FAILURE TO INFORM IMMEDIATELY WILL RESULT IN THE CLIENT LOOSING THE ENTIRE DEPOSIT DUE TO A VERY SERIOUS BREACH OF CONTRACT. In the event of an accident, a written accident report must be filed, detailing the causes, circumstances, and consequences of the occurrence, as well as, if known, the name, surname, and address of the person responsible for the incident and the witnesses, as well as the names and addresses of the injured parties, if any. An accident, for the purposes of this contract, is any fortuitous, spontaneous, external, or violent event.

EXCLUDED RENTAL PRICE CONCEPTS

Neither fuel consumption nor stays at ports other than the vessel's home port are included in the contract price, which will always be at the TENANT/CLIENT's expense.

FUEL. The TENANT/CLIENT must return the vessel to L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L with a full fuel tank and it is mandatory to provide the fuel receipt to Sailway staff at the moment of check-out of the boat. If not refueled, the total consumed will be deducted from your deposit plus a penalty of 50€ + VAT for breach of contract.

INSURANCE

The vessel covered under this contract has an accident and liability insurance policy. The vessel carries on board the coverage certificate issued by the insurance company.

The client acknowledges having read the insurance conditions and agrees to the contracted coverage, obliging themselves to comply with said terms and obligations. The client will be liable for any damage, loss, property, or human injury occurring during the use of the vessel, up to a maximum of €2,500 for sailing boats and €1,500 for motorboats.

In the event of any accident affecting the rented vessel, its crew, passengers, third parties, or any type of property, the tenant must file a written accident report, notifying L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L of the causes, circumstances, and effects of the incident, as well as the names, surnames, and addresses of the person responsible for the incident, of the witnesses, and of the injured parties if any.

USE OF THE VESSEL

The vessel subject to this contract will be exclusively designated for recreational sailing, and may not be used for commercial, lucrative, or illegal operations.

The TENANT/CLIENT agrees to use the rented vessel as if it were their own, according to the standards of good navigation, and to respect the regulations established by maritime, customs, health, and tax authorities, as well as national or foreign police authorities if applicable. In the event of an infringement of the ordinances by the Tenant, they will assume all penalties, fines, etc.

The vessel must only navigate within the waters authorized for its category. Under no circumstances may the vessel leave Spanish jurisdictional waters. The Tenant agrees not to carry on board a number of people greater than the number permitted according to the safety certificate. Should the tenant wish to participate in a sports competition or regatta during their rental period, it is mandatory to notify L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L of this intention and to pay the corresponding additional fee for the mandatory specific insurance to be able to participate with the vessel subject to this contract.

The TENANT/CLIENT assures that they possess the knowledge and experience necessary to conduct the cruise and that they hold the necessary nautical title for this purpose. The TENANT/CLIENT agrees not to subcontract or sublease the vessel in full or in part. The TENANT/CLIENT assures that the skipper designated in this contract possesses the knowledge and experience required to safely govern the rented vessel, that they hold the required legal title in Spain, and that they will have it available to the relevant authorities during the duration of this contract. During the validity of this contract, L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L is exempt from any liability that may arise from the lack or insufficiency of knowledge of the skipper.

L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L reserves the right to cancel this contract if the skipper does not possess sufficient training and competence to safely govern the vessel. L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L does not take any responsibility for the validity of the title in Spanish territory, whether a Spanish or foreign nautical title. Any responsibility, incident, fine, or sanction arising from such title will be the total responsibility of the TENANT/CLIENT.

The Tenant agrees not to bring animals on board unless authorized by L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L.

The boarding of weapons, narcotics, and products that may contravene Spanish legislation is strictly prohibited.

Towing other vessels is completely prohibited except in cases of emergency; likewise, the rented vessel will only be allowed to be towed in the same cases, and always with its own lines to avoid high salvage costs. The TENANT/CLIENT will not accept agreements or assume responsibilities without the authorization of L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L.

The TENANT/CLIENT agrees not to leave the vessel moored or anchored, without any person on board, in open waters or unprotected waters.

The TENANT/CLIENT will be responsible for any damage or harm caused to the rented vessel during the rental period, and for the loss or misplacement of any of its elements or accessories including the paddle board, electric motor, or auxiliary vessel.

In the event of unfavorable weather reports regarding weather conditions or sea (above force 6 Beaufort or starting from 25 knots of wind), the Tenant agrees not to leave the port they are in or to head to the nearest safe port or anchorage.

L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L is not responsible for the theft or loss of the auxiliary vessel. Its loss or breakage will be deducted from the deposit.

RETURN OF THE VESSEL

The TENANT/CLIENT will return the vessel at the place and date indicated in the Particular Conditions of this contract, in the same condition as received, with full fuel and water tanks and with equipment and supplies organized and properly stowed. If not returned under these conditions, the cost of refilling these tanks will be deducted from the deposit.

The TENANT/CLIENT must plan the cruise to return the vessel within the contracted timeframe, taking into account possible adverse situations that may arise. If due to abrupt and unforeseen bad weather, the return of the vessel is delayed, the TENANT/CLIENT is obliged to immediately inform L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L of such facts.

Delivery of the vessel outside the agreed timings during check-in will incur a penalty of 60€ + VAT for each hour of delay in the return of the vessel, an amount that will be automatically deducted from the deposited deposit. Bad weather cannot be invoked as a cause for delay.

Upon returning the vessel, L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L will conduct an inspection of the vessel, as well as its inventory and equipment. If any damage is found on the vessel or loss or breakage of its equipment due to misuse, L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L will deduct from the deposit the amount necessary to repair such damages. Should there be discrepancies between the parties regarding the conditions for the return of the vessel and inventoried goods, the deposit will be returned at the time of the settlement of the dispute.

The vessel must be returned to the same port where it was delivered or as previously agreed by the parties.

To return it to a different port, the TENANT/CLIENT needs express written permission from SAILWAY S.L. The TENANT/CLIENT will bear all costs arising from this change of return location.

DELAYS IN RETURN

In the event of a delay in the return of the vessel, the TENANT/CLIENT will be obliged:

  • to pay SAILWAY S.L double the daily rental rate for each day of delay in returning the vessel.
  • to bear all expenses that arise from this delay, both for SAILWAY S.L and for its clients who have contracted the vessel for the following periods.

If 24 hours after the end of the contract, the vessel has not been returned nor news of it has been received, a search will be initiated, notifying its disappearance to the maritime authorities. The costs arising from this will be borne by the TENANT/CLIENT.

Time taken for the repair of damages to the vessel or the second repair of those that, repaired or ordered to be repaired by the tenant, have not been properly repaired, shall also be considered a delay in return.

DAMAGES, THEFTS, ACCIDENTS, AND BREAKDOWNS.

If L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L were to delay in delivering the vessel or it was impossible to deliver it due to breakdowns or any cause beyond the company's control, a vessel of equal or similar characteristics will be provided. If this is not possible, at the client's request, an inferior category vessel will be provided (with a proportional refund of the difference in rental price) or the client may request the termination of this contract and a refund of the amount paid to date without being able to use the vessel.

If during the rental period, the rented vessel suffers breakdowns, damages, defects, or loss of equipment, the tenant is obliged to immediately notify L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L, which will give the appropriate instructions to follow.

Should accidents occur involving third parties, these must be reported by the tenant to the competent authorities.

The TENANT/CLIENT must immediately notify L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L of any accident, mishap, breakdown, or incident regardless of its nature. FAILURE TO INFORM IMMEDIATELY WILL RESULT IN THE TENANT/CLIENT LOSING THE ENTIRE DEPOSIT DUE TO A VERY SERIOUS BREACH OF CONTRACT. In the case of accidents, the TENANT/CLIENT must file a written accident report, detailing the causes, circumstances, and consequences of the incident, as well as, if known; the name, surname, and address of the person responsible for the event and of the witnesses as well as the names and addresses of any injured parties if applicable. The tenant agrees to cooperate with the rental company and the Insurance Company in the investigation and defense of any claim and process.

If due to a breakdown occurring during the rental or other causes not attributable to the tenant, it is impossible to continue in the rented vessel, L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L will reimburse the proportional amount for the days in which the vessel could not be used or will provide a vessel of similar characteristics. In no case will this give right to an extension of the rental period. The TENANT/CLIENT will not order any repair without first indicating the breakdown to L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L, who must grant permission. The costs of repairs will be borne by the landlord. Breakdowns resulting from negligence, incompetence, or improper use of the vessel by the TENANT/CLIENT will be paid for in full by the latter, and L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L will terminate this contract and reserve the right to claim for damages and losses that may arise from the breakdown. In such cases, the provisions of the first paragraph of this condition shall not apply. The TENANT/CLIENT must take special care with the use and handling of the toilet to avoid any breakdown or blockage. No toilet paper, intimate hygiene items, wipes, or any other item that could cause a blockage may be thrown away. Any disregard for these rules causing a blockage of any kind in the toilet during the rental period will require the client to pay the amount of 450€ + VAT for damages caused to the company. If this payment is not made, the rental/charter company SAILWAY S.L reserves the right to deduct it from the deposit amount or to charge it to the client's credit card.

The TENANT/CLIENT relieves SAILWAY S.L, the landlord of all responsibility for losses or damages occurring to items left, stored, or transported by the tenant or by any other person on board, within or on the vessel subject to the contract, whether before or during the validity of this.

In case of theft and/or disappearance of the vessel, the tenant is obliged to file the corresponding report of the event with the competent authority, delivering it to the rental company.

CANCELLATION AND TERMINATION

The TENANT/CLIENT may proceed with the cancellation of this contract with cancellation costs as follows:

  • if the cancellation occurs more than 30 days before the start of the rental period, 30% of the rental price will be paid to SAILWAY S.L.
  • if the cancellation occurs less than 30 days before the start of the rental period, 100% of the rental price will be paid to SAILWAY S.L.

In the event of negligence in the use of the vessel violating applicable legislation, this will be grounds for the automatic termination of the contract, and any amounts paid will favor SAILWAY S.L.

If the documentation presented by the tenant does not qualify them to govern the vessel or does not prove their sufficient and necessary technical competence, the contract will be terminated immediately, retaining the amounts paid to date (except for the deposit which will be returned) as compensation for damages in favor of L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L.

TERMINATION AT THE LANDLORD'S REQUEST

SAILWAY S.L may terminate this contract if, for reasons beyond its control, it cannot make available to the Tenant the contracted vessel on the date it is to be delivered. In such case, SAILWAY S.L will refund the TENANT/CLIENT the amount paid corresponding to the total amount of rental days not enjoyed. Under no circumstances may the TENANT/CLIENT claim from LANDLORD/SAILWAY S.L compensation for the unavailability of the vessel subject to this contract.

ADMINISTRATIVE RETENTIONS

Negligence or improper use of the boat in violation of applicable legislation by the TENANT/CLIENT will be sufficient grounds for the immediate termination of the contract, retaining all amounts paid up until that moment in favor of SAILWAY S.L without the right to reimbursement by the tenant. In the event of violation by the client of customs ordinances or any other Administration, they shall be liable for all fines, penalties, or responsibilities that may arise, as well as all their consequences. In case of seizure of the vessel, the client will pay the lessor as compensation for damages and losses caused an amount equal to double the daily rental price for each day that elapses until the vessel's restitution and delivery occurs. In case of confiscation, the client will pay the full value of the vessel within eight days. In both cases, the TENANT/CLIENT will lose the amounts paid to the benefit of SAILWAY.

APPLICABLE LEGISLATION AND COMPETENT JURISDICTION

The applicable law will be Spanish law. The parties expressly submit, for issues that may arise from this contract, to the jurisdiction of the courts and Tribunals of Vigo, expressly waiving any other jurisdiction that may correspond to them under Spanish legislation.

CONFIDENTIALITY AND DATA PROTECTION

The parties agree to maintain absolute confidentiality about the information and documentation provided or accessed during the provision of the Service, not to reveal, or use directly or indirectly the information derived from this contractual relationship.
